verb
- past tense of remodel; changed the structure or appearance of something, especially a building
adjective
- having been changed in structure or appearance; renovated
Examples
- They remodeled their kitchen last summer.
- The remodeled bathroom looks much more modern.
- We remodeled the entire first floor of our house.
- The remodeled office space can accommodate more employees.
- She remodeled her business plan after the initial failure.
- The newly remodeled restaurant reopened with great fanfare.
